Choosing the Right Size Black Stainless Steel Bracelet for Your Wrist

Black stainless steel bracelets are a trendy and stylish accessory that can complement any outfit. However, choosing the right size bracelet is essential for ensuring a comfortable and flattering fit. Here’s a comprehensive guide to help you determine the perfect size black stainless steel bracelet for your wrist:

Measure Your Wrist

The first step is to measure your wrist circumference. Use a flexible measuring tape or a piece of string to wrap snugly around your wrist at the point where you intend to wear the bracelet. Mark the point where the tape or string meets and measure the length from the mark to the end of the tape using a ruler or measuring stick.

Consider Your Preference

Black stainless steel bracelets come in various lengths and widths. Your personal style and preferences will influence the optimal size for you. If you prefer a snug fit, opt for a bracelet that is slightly smaller than your wrist measurement. For a more relaxed fit, choose a bracelet that is a bit larger.

Account for Bangle Size

Bangles, which are closed bracelets that slip over the hand, require a larger size than bracelets with traditional clasps. As a general rule, add approximately 1 inch (2.54 cm) to your wrist measurement when choosing a bangle bracelet.

Consider the Bracelet Design

The design of the bracelet can also impact the perceived size. A chunky, wide bracelet will appear larger than a thin, narrow one, even if they have the same length. If you prefer a statement piece, choose a wider bracelet. For a more subtle touch, opt for a narrower design.

Consider Adjustability

Some black stainless steel bracelets feature adjustable clasps or links that allow for a customizable fit. These adjustable bracelets provide greater flexibility in sizing, ensuring a comfortable and perfect fit for almost any wrist.

Additional Tips

If you are between sizes, it’s generally better to choose the larger size and have it adjusted if necessary.

Try on the bracelet before purchasing to ensure a comfortable fit.

Avoid bracelets that are too tight, as they can restrict blood flow or cause discomfort.

Consider the thickness and style of your watch when pairing it with a bracelet. A bulky watch may require a larger bracelet to balance the look.
